&lt;p&gt;Float flyers not on amphibs  DON&#039;T LAND HERE!!!! the lake is drying up and I have been told that the estimated water depth is only a couple of feet.  ( I know one guy torn a float open on rocks in 2009 ) &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Nice Airport , I trained here in 2007 ( yes I know how to use the radio!! , Academy now has a company freq.)  also 123.2 is a common freq. in this area of AB with many airports sharing the radio! &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Edmonton Airports hasn&#039;t invested a lot into the Airport for many years, They are focused elsewhere ( International-CYEG and Villeneuve CZVL)&lt;/p&gt;</description>
